- Coccolith assemblages of core MD00-2354 are used for reconstructing primary productivity in the northwestern Arabian Sea. The results cover the last 23,000 years. The attached data are original coccolith counting by using a polarized light microscope, and primary productivity. Counting result of each coccolith species is shown by the sum of counting number (n) in all fields of view. Primary productivity (gC m^-2 yr^-2) is calculated by an empirical equation that convert the percentage of lower euphotic zone species Florisphaera profunda to primary productivity. Details can be found in the related article.
